AERI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2018 in Review

160 of the 4,489 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Aerie Pharmaceuticals (AERI) for Q4 2018, worth a combined $1.76B — down 40% from $2.96B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 35 funds closed out of AERI and 19 opened new positions — a net loss of 16 holders — while 56 trimmed existing stakes and 65 added.

The largest buyer was Bank of New York Mellon, adding an estimated $39.2M. The largest seller was HealthCor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$63.5M sold.
